Output 3ecbb32dbcb8945455832bdda51c9e2fe2cfa647342c046c2caef0a28f9f3829:1

value
70998945
script pubkey
OP_0 OP_PUSHBYTES_20 27bd05584cbaee1cd93539a74aab549104dd352a
address
bc1qy77s2kzvhthpekf48xn54265jyzd6df259d2yx
transaction
3ecbb32dbcb8945455832bdda51c9e2fe2cfa647342c046c2caef0a28f9f3829
spent
true